Buffalo Hosts Epic Showdown

The Colorado Avalanche are set to face the Buffalo Sabres in an exciting matchup at KeyBank Center. The game begins at 10:30 a.m. MT, marking the beginning of the Avalanche’s first multi-game road trip this season. This is the first of two meetings between the teams, with the next matchup scheduled for November 13 in Denver.
Latest Game Results
The Avalanche recently played against the Dallas Stars, narrowly losing 5-4 in a shootout. Nathan MacKinnon and Martin Necas contributed significantly, each recording one goal and two assists. Additionally, Artturi Lehkonen scored, while rookie Gavin Brindley netted his first NHL goal during the game. The defeat came after Dallas took a lead, with MacKinnon tying the game late in the third period.
On the other hand, the Sabres faced the Boston Bruins, losing 3-1. Boston took an early lead with goals from Pavel Zacha and Mark Kastelic, while Jason Zucker managed to score for Buffalo in the third period. However, an empty-net goal from Sean Kuraly sealed the game for the Bruins.

Historical Context
The Avalanche have a solid history against the Sabres, boasting a record of 27 wins, 12 losses, and 4 ties in 43 encounters. Last season, Colorado won both matchups, showcasing resilience by coming back from significant deficits in each game.

Player Highlights
MacKinnon has excelled against the Sabres, tallying 29 points in 18 games. Gabriel Landeskog has also made his mark with 14 points in 15 matchups, while Necas has contributed significantly with 12 points in 11 games against Buffalo. Sabres goaltender Alex Lyon holds a .919 save percentage this season, underscoring his impact on the ice.
